Where is the Best Place to See the Sunrise in the Blue Mountains?

0 Comments


The Blue Mountains in New South Wales, Australia, is a popular tourist destination known for its stunning natural beauty and breathtaking landscapes. One of the most magical experiences visitors can have is witnessing the sunrise over the Blue Mountains. In this article, we will explore some of the best places to catch this awe-inspiring sight.

The Three Sisters

The Three Sisters is undoubtedly one of the most iconic attractions in the Blue Mountains. These massive rock formations create a breathtaking backdrop for watching the sunrise. Arriving early in the morning, visitors can witness the mountains gradually revealing their beauty as the sun rises over the horizon.

Govetts Leap Lookout

Located near Blackheath, Govetts Leap Lookout offers a panoramic view of the Grose Valley and surrounding mountains. The lookout provides a perfect vantage point to see the sunrise over the vast expanse of untouched wilderness. It is a highly recommended spot for avid photographers seeking to capture the first rays of sunlight illuminating the Blue Mountains.

Pulpit Rock Lookout

Pulpit Rock Lookout, situated near Blackheath as well, is another fantastic spot for sunrise photography. This secluded cliff-edge viewpoint provides a unique perspective of the mountains as they bask in the soft morning light. Visitors can witness breathtaking colors and silhouettes as the sun paints the sky in shades of orange and pink.

Mount Solitary

Mount Solitary offers a more challenging adventure for sunrise enthusiasts. This solitary peak, located within the Blue Mountains National Park, rewards hikers with unparalleled views of the surrounding wilderness. After a rigorous hike, being greeted by the sunrise atop Mount Solitary is an experience that will stay with visitors forever.

Lincoln’s Rock

Lincoln’s Rock is a popular spot for those seeking a unique vantage point for sunrise photography. Located in Wentworth Falls, this rock formation offers an uninterrupted view of the Jamison Valley. Arriving early is crucial, as many photographers flock to this spot to capture the perfect shot of the sun rising above the valley.

Echo Point Lookout

Lastly, Echo Point Lookout is a tourist hotspot in Katoomba and an ideal spot for watching the sunrise. With its close proximity to the Three Sisters, the lookout offers a stunning view of these iconic formations as they become illuminated by the first rays of sunlight. It is a must-visit spot for both locals and tourists alike.

There are several remarkable places in the Blue Mountains to witness the beauty of the sunrise. Whether it’s the iconic Three Sisters, the panoramic views from Govetts Leap Lookout, the solitude of Mount Solitary, or the unique perspectives from Pulpit Rock Lookout and Lincoln’s Rock, each spot offers a magical experience.
